Ce que dit la marque
Rich dark fruits infused with zesty cranberry & maple syrup. In southern Tanzania, a region historically dominated by commercial coffee, quality processing is unearthing unique coffees from the Mkulima Kwanza Co-operative. This coffee, grown at 1700 meters above sea level, is a celebration of the co-op members' farming and processing by Communal Shamba. Working closely together, they’ve sorted out the naturally occurring Peaberry – where only one seed matures in the cherry – and put it through the washed process. Not only a delicious, unique expression of coffee from the Songwe region, but the sale of these coffees is also supporting community education and health initiatives. Delicious + impactful: right up our alley! === Suggested Recipe ~~~ In: 21.5g Out: 44g Time: 28sec Temp: 95°C ===
